How correlated are KOD and PTON?
Over the past 3 years, KOD and PTON moved with a correlation of 0.47, which is moderate. Little has changed lately, as the 1-year reading of 0.42 lands near the 3-year figure. Over 5 years the correlation is 0.38, and the annualized covariance of weekly returns is 4325.8 %².
Within KOD's tracked universe of 12 assets, PTON comes in at #6 by 3-year correlation. Their recent paths diverged sharply: over the last 12 months KOD outperformed by 349.8 percentage points (+318.8% for KOD against -31.0% for PTON). Note the risk asymmetry: KOD runs 1.7 times the annualized volatility of the other leg, so equal-weighting the two is not an equal-risk position.
How is this computed?
Pearson correlation on weekly returns: ρ(A,B) = cov(rA, rB) / (σA · σB), over windows of 52, 156 and 260 weeks. Covariance is annualized (×52) and expressed in %². Full definitions on the methodology page.

What does a correlation of 0.47 mean?
Correlation ranges from −1 to +1. Values near +1 mean two assets move together, near 0 that they move independently, and negative values that they tend to move in opposite directions. It measures co-movement, not performance.
